1. AI-Powered Customer Service
Customer expectations for quick and efficient service are higher than ever. AI-powered customer support tools, such as chatbots and virtual assistants, enable small businesses to provide 24/7 assistance without the need for large support teams.
Platforms like ManyChat and Tidio can handle routine customer inquiries, freeing up resources to focus on complex issues. By integrating these tools, businesses can enhance customer satisfaction and build long-term loyalty.
2. Personalization at Scale
Personalized experiences are no longer a luxury; they are a necessity in today’s market. AI small business solutions like ActiveCampaign and Mailchimp with AI features analyze customer data to craft tailored marketing campaigns, product recommendations, and communication strategies.
This level of personalization improves customer engagement and drives sales, giving small businesses a competitive edge in crowded markets.
3. AI for Financial Management
Managing finances efficiently is critical for small businesses. AI tools such as Xero and QuickBooks AI Insights simplify bookkeeping, expense tracking, and financial forecasting.
AI-powered financial management solutions help businesses maintain accurate records, reduce errors, and make informed decisions based on real-time insights. These tools are especially valuable for Australian small businesses navigating tax regulations and compliance requirements.
4. Advanced Marketing Automation
AI is revolutionizing digital marketing by automating repetitive tasks and optimizing campaigns. Tools like Adzooma and Hootsuite Insights allow small businesses to monitor social media performance, track audience engagement, and adjust advertising strategies in real-time.
AI also identifies high-performing keywords and trends, enabling businesses to fine-tune their content for better search engine rankings and increased visibility online.
5. Inventory Management and E-Commerce Solutions
AI has become a game-changer for retail and e-commerce businesses in Australia. Platforms like Shopify AI and BigCommerce AI optimize inventory management by predicting demand, tracking stock levels, and automating reordering processes.
For small businesses in the e-commerce space, these solutions reduce waste, improve cash flow, and ensure products are always available for customers.
6. AI for Workforce Productivity
AI tools are helping small businesses boost productivity by automating time-consuming administrative tasks. Solutions like Trello AI features and Slack with AI integrations streamline project management, improve team communication, and enhance overall workflow.
For small businesses with limited staff, these tools make it easier to stay organized and meet deadlines without overextending resources.
7. Predictive Analytics for Business Growth
AI-powered predictive analytics tools, such as Tableau and IBM Watson Studio, allow small businesses to make data-driven decisions. By analyzing historical data, these tools forecast trends, identify customer preferences, and predict future sales.
This trend helps Australian small businesses develop strategic plans, allocate resources effectively, and stay ahead of the competition.
8. AI for Sustainable Business Practices
Sustainability is becoming a key priority for businesses in Australia. AI is helping small businesses reduce their environmental footprint through energy-efficient systems and supply chain optimization.
For instance, AI tools for energy monitoring can help reduce utility costs, while smart logistics solutions optimize delivery routes to minimize fuel consumption.
Embracing AI: Steps for Australian Small Businesses
To harness the power of AI, small businesses in Australia should follow these steps:
Assess Your Needs: Identify areas where AI can address challenges, such as customer service, marketing, or inventory management.
Start Small: Test AI tools with pilot projects before scaling up their implementation.
Invest in Training: Ensure your team understands how to use AI tools effectively.
Choose Scalable Solutions: Select tools that can grow with your business as demands increase.
